This is a description for an Advanced Sanitizer Spray with 70% Ethyl Alcohol. The spray is flammable and should be kept away from heat, spark, or flame. It is for external use only and effective in reducing bacteria on the skin. The directions recommend rubbing hands together for 15 seconds and allowing the spray to dry without wiping. It includes drug facts, warnings, and inactive ingredients. The product is highlighted as an Official Licensed Product of the American Red Cross, which encourages preparedness for emergencies.
